English: Former Colbert Report executive producer Allison Silverman, Late Night with Jimmy Fallon writer Morgan Murphy, writer and Second City alums Jenny Hagel and Megan Kellie, and musical guests Peacock’s Penny Arcade take the stage at 92YTribeca for a special night of performance and discussion. After our line-up of funny ladies show off their comedy chops they’ll sit down for a round-table discussion about their perspectives on the historically male-dominated world of comedy and the historically humorless world of feminism. Hosted by DoubleX editors Hanna Rosin, Emily Bazelon and Jessica Grose.
